Average Cost of an Ebike: What Buyers Should Know
Electric bikes, or ebikes, have surged in popularity across the United States, offering an eco-friendly and efficient alternative for commuting, recreation, and fitness. However, the price of an ebike varies widely depending on factors such as technology, brand, battery capacity, and intended use. Understanding the average cost of an ebike from several perspectives can help consumers make informed decisions and find a model that fits their budget and lifestyle.
| Type of Ebike | Price Range (USD) | Key Features |
|---|---|---|
| Entry-Level Commuter | $800 – $1,500 | Basic motor, limited range, lightweight frame |
| Mid-Range All-Purpose | $1,500 – $3,000 | Enhanced battery, better components, moderate range |
| High-End Performance | $3,000 – $7,000+ | Powerful motors, long-range batteries, premium parts |
| Specialized Ebikes (Cargo, Mountain) | $2,000 – $8,000+ | Heavy-duty build, specific uses, advanced technology |
Factors Influencing the Cost of an Ebike
The price of an ebike depends on several key factors. Battery type and capacity often drive cost differences, as lithium-ion batteries with longer ranges cost more. Motor power measured in watts affects performance and price, with stronger motors adding to expenses. Frame materials such as aluminum, carbon fiber, or steel also vary in cost, influencing overall bike durability and weight.
Additional features like integrated lights, digital displays, suspension systems, and advanced gearing can increase the price significantly. Brand reputation and warranty coverage also affect retail cost, with premium companies charging more due to quality assurance and customer service.
Average Cost Based on Ebike Categories
Entry-Level Commuter Ebikes
These models cater to daily commuters and casual riders on paved surfaces. They feature lower-powered motors (250W to 350W), smaller batteries (250Wh to 400Wh), and basic components. Prices usually range from $800 to $1,500, making them accessible for first-time buyers or those with budget constraints. Such bikes generally provide 20 to 40 miles of range per charge.
Mid-Range All-Purpose Ebikes
Mid-tier ebikes offer a balance of performance and affordability. Expect motors between 350W and 500W and battery capacities from 400Wh to 600Wh. These bikes often come with improved suspension systems, larger tires, and more reliable braking. Pricing varies from $1,500 to $3,000 and suits riders seeking daily usability combined with recreational versatility.
High-End Performance Ebikes
Models in this category prioritize speed, range, and top-level components. Motors typically exceed 500W, and batteries commonly deliver 700Wh or more, extending ranges beyond 50 miles. Built with durable frames and premium accessories, these ebikes cost $3,000 to $7,000 or higher. These options appeal to serious enthusiasts and those needing powerful electric assistance for challenging terrains.
Specialized Ebikes: Cargo and Mountain Bikes
Specialized ebikes designed for cargo hauling or off-road use carry a wider price range due to unique build requirements. Cargo ebikes, equipped with reinforced frames and load-carrying platforms, tend to cost $2,000 to $6,000. Mountain ebikes, optimized for rough trails with suspension and high-torque motors, range from $3,000 to over $8,000. Both categories feature robust designs for durability and performance in specific environments.
Average Cost of Ebike Components and Their Impact
| Component | Typical Price Range (USD) | Impact on Total Cost |
|---|---|---|
| Battery Pack (Lithium-ion) | $400 – $1,200 | Largest cost driver; affects range and lifespan |
| Electric Motor | $300 – $1,000 | Determines power and bike responsiveness |
| Frame Material and Design | $200 – $1,000+ | Affects bike weight and durability |
| Controller and Display | $100 – $500 | Influences user interface and customization |
| Suspension Systems | $150 – $800 | Increases comfort and off-road performance |
| Brakes and Tires | $100 – $600 | Ensures safety and ride quality |
Cost Considerations: New vs. Used Ebikes
New ebikes often come with warranties, the latest technology, and guaranteed quality but are priced higher due to retail markups and newer components. Entry-level new ebikes start around $800, increasing with features and brand prestige.
Used ebikes can be a cost-effective option, frequently priced 30% to 50% less than new models. Buyers should carefully inspect battery health, motor functionality, and wear on components to ensure value. Buying from reputable dealers or certified pre-owned programs can mitigate risks.
Used ebikes offer significant savings but may require additional investment in maintenance or replacements over time.
Additional Costs to Factor Into Ebike Ownership
- Charging Equipment: While most ebikes come with chargers, upgrades to faster or portable chargers can cost $50 to $200.
- Maintenance and Repairs: Expect to budget $100 to $300 annually for tune-ups, brake adjustments, and battery care.
- Accessories: Helmets, locks, lights, racks, and panniers may add $100 to $500 depending on preferences.
- Insurance and Registration: Some jurisdictions encourage or require registration and may offer insurance options.
Regional Price Variations and Incentives
Ebike prices can vary across the U.S. due to factors like local demand, tax policies, and supply chain logistics. Urban areas with strong cycling cultures often feature higher costs but also offer more retail competition and customer service options.
Additionally, many states and municipalities provide incentives such as rebates, tax credits, or grants to encourage ebike purchases. These incentives can significantly reduce the effective cost, sometimes by several hundred dollars. Buyers should research local programs to maximize savings.
